1. Alpha Vantage β Best Free Market Data MCP
Alpha Vantage offers the most generous free tier for market data access. It provides real-time and historical data for stocks, ETFs, mutual funds, currencies, and cryptocurrencies through a simple REST API that works seamlessly with MCP clients.
- Real-time and historical market data
- Generous free tier (25 API calls per day)
- Support for stocks, forex, crypto, and commodities
- Technical indicator calculations
- Simple REST API compatible with any MCP client
Pros: Best free tier available, wide asset coverage, simple setup, well-documented API.
Cons: Rate limits on free tier, premium plans needed for high-volume usage, data quality varies for international markets.
2. Financial Modeling Prep β Best for Fundamental Data
Financial Modeling Prep specializes in fundamental financial data β income statements, balance sheets, cash flow statements, and financial ratios. It is the go-to MCP server for AI agents that need to analyze company financials in depth.
- Detailed financial statements and SEC filings data
- Financial ratios and metrics calculation
- Company profiles and market data
- Discounted cash flow (DCF) data
- Affordable premium plans
Pros: Best-in-class fundamental data, excellent for financial analysis AI agents, comprehensive ratios and metrics.
Cons: Less focus on real-time trading data, free tier is more limited than Alpha Vantage.
3. Yahoo Finance β Best for Broad Market Coverage
Yahoo Finance is one of the most widely used financial data sources, and its MCP server provides access to its comprehensive dataset including market data, news, earnings data, and analyst estimates.
- Comprehensive market data coverage
- Financial news and sentiment data
- Earnings estimates and analyst ratings
- Historical data with adjustable intervals
- Free access via community-maintained MCP servers
Pros: Broadest data coverage including news and sentiment, free access, huge community support.
Cons: Unofficial MCP implementations may have reliability issues, data format can change without notice.
4. Stripe MCP β Best for Payment Processing
Stripe MCP connects AI agents directly to Stripe's payment infrastructure. It enables agents to process payments, manage subscriptions, handle refunds, and generate revenue reports through natural language commands.
- Payment processing and refund management
- Subscription and billing management
- Revenue reporting and analytics
- Customer management and invoicing
- Official Stripe-supported MCP server
Pros: Official Stripe support, comprehensive payment features, excellent documentation.
Cons: Requires Stripe account, focused only on payments, transaction fees apply.
5. QuickBooks MCP β Best for Accounting Data
QuickBooks MCP gives AI agents access to QuickBooks accounting data β invoices, expenses, reports, and customer information. It is essential for building AI agents that can interact with small business accounting systems.
- Access to invoices, expenses, and accounting reports
- Customer and vendor data management
- Chart of accounts access
- Integration with QuickBooks Online
- Real-time financial reporting
Pros: Direct access to QuickBooks data, enables accounting automation, real-time reporting.
Cons: Requires QuickBooks subscription, limited to QuickBooks ecosystem, setup requires OAuth authentication.
6. Alpaca β Best for Trading Automation
Alpaca provides commission-free trading via API, and its MCP server enables AI agents to execute trades, manage portfolios, and monitor market positions programmatically.
- Commission-free trading via API
- Portfolio management and rebalancing
- Real-time market data and order execution
- Paper trading for strategy testing
- Crypto trading support
Pros: Commission-free trading, excellent paper trading environment, strong API documentation.
Cons: Requires brokerage account, subject to market risks, limited to supported asset classes.
Comparison Table
| Server | Data Type | Access Level | Setup Complexity | Free Tier |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Alpha Vantage | Market data, technicals | API key | Low | Yes (25 calls/day) |
| Financial Modeling Prep | Fundamental data, ratios | API key | Low | Limited |
| Yahoo Finance | Market data, news, estimates | Public | Medium | Yes |
| Stripe MCP | Payment processing | OAuth/API key | Medium | No |
| QuickBooks MCP | Accounting data | OAuth | Medium | No |
| Alpaca | Trading, portfolio | API key | Low | Paper trading |
